Output 8bcb34ebade42953afc7cb7e7c88ec006d23e7ad6d622ed1c12b119070f73625:1

value
124175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f617f32079248b2ee154fb753cc704d1828b675 OP_EQUAL
address
3Em9MB9yQLRQUzuDfLitgggsePWL5MDSE1
transaction
8bcb34ebade42953afc7cb7e7c88ec006d23e7ad6d622ed1c12b119070f73625
confirmations
217524
spent
true